Musically, I think this might be their strongest album since Viva la Vida. There aren't many artists who can pull off this kind of variety in musical styles the way that Coldplay do.

 

I was very surprised about some of the songs, for example I really wasn't expecting a gospel song. It's something I wouldn't normally listen to but I actually really like that about this album.

 

I also like the topics that they've covered and the messages in the songs.

 

Overall, it's refreshing and inspiring, and it really shows off how talented they are.

 

My personal favourites are Champion of the world, Broken, Guns and Trouble in Town.
